BLANCA v. COUNTY OF NASSAU


65 N.Y.2d 712 (1985)

Blanca C. and Others, Infants, by their Mother and Natural Guardian, Carmen M., et al., Appellants, v. County of Nassau et al., Respondents, et al., Defendants.

Court of Appeals of the State of New York.

Decided June 4, 1985.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Edward B. Joachim and Jeffrey S. Lisabeth for appellants.

Edward G. McCabe, County Attorney (Joshua A. Elkin of counsel), for respondents.

Robert Abrams, Attorney-General (Michael S. Buskus, Robert Hermann and Peter H. Schiff of counsel), amicus curiae.

Chief Judge WACHTLER and Judges JASEN, MEYER, SIMONS, KAYE and ALEXANDER concur; Judge TITONE taking no part.


MEMORANDUM.

The order of the Appellate Division should be affirmed, without costs.

We agree, for the reasons stated in the opinion of Justice David T. Gibbons (103 A.D.2d 524, 530-532; see, Hawley v State of New York, 16 N.Y.2d 809), that defendant County is not vicariously responsible for the injuries inflicted by the foster parents...
